Quarter 2 exam civic
|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| Under our constitution, some powers belong to the states. What is one power of the states? | * provide schooling and education * provide protection (police) *provide safety (fire departments) *give a drivers license * Approve zoning,and land use |
| What does the constitution do? | * set up the government * defines the government * protects basic rights of Americans |
| When is the last day you can send in federal income tax forms? | April 15 |
| How old do you have to be to vote for president? | 18 and older |
| What is the name of the president of the United States now? | Joe Biden |
| The idea of self government is in the first three words of the constitution. What are these words? | We the people |
| Who is the commander-in-chief of the military? | The president |
| Who is in charge of the executive branch? | The president |
| We elect the US senator, for how many years | Six years |
| What does the president cabinet do? | Advises the president |
| What is the economic system in the United States? | *capitalist economy * market economy |
| What does the US senator represent? | All people of the state |
| Who signed bills to become laws | The President |
| If both the president and the vice president can no longer serve who becomes president | The speaker of the house |
| What is the name of the speaker of the House of Representatives now? | Mike Johnson |
| The House of Representatives has how many voting members | 435 |
| In what month do we vote for president? | November |
| What are two ways that Americans can participate in their democracy | *Vote *join a political party *help with a campaign *run for office *join a community group |
| What are two rights of everyone living in the United States? | *Freedom of speech * freedom of assembly *freedom to petition the government, * the right to bear arms *freedom of expression |
| Name one right only for the United States citizens | *Vote in a federal election *run for federal office |
| What is the supreme law of the land? | The constitution |
| We elect a US representative, for how many years | 2 |
| How many justices are on the Supreme Court | 9 |
| Who is the chief justice of the United States now? | John Roberts |
| What is the rule of law? | * everyone must follow the law * leaders must obey the law * no one is above the law |
| What are two rights in the declaration of independence | * life * liberty * pursuit of happiness |
| There are four amendments to the constitution about who can vote describe one of them | * citizens 18 and older can vote * you don’t have to pay to vote * Any citizen can vote * a male of any race can vote |
| What is the highest court in the United States? | The supreme court |
| What steps, one branch of government from coming to powerful | * check balances * separation of powers |
| What is one promise you make when you become a United States citizen? | * Give up loyalty to other countries * defend the constitution and laws of the United States * obey the laws of the United States * The military needed * serve the nation * be loyal to the United States |
| How many amendments does the constitution have? | 27 |
| Under our constitution, some powers belong to the federal government. What is one power of the federal government | * to print money * to declare war * to create an army * to make treaties |
| How many US senators are there? | 100 |
| Who makes federal laws | *Congress * Senate and House of Representatives * US national legislator |
| What are two cabinet level positions? | * attorney general * vice President * secretary of agriculture * secretary of commerce * secretary of defense * Secretary of education * Secretary of state |
| What are the two parts of the US Congress? | The senate and House of Representatives |
| What is one responsibility that is only for United States citizens | * Serve on a jury * vote in a federal election |
| What do we call the first 10 amendments to the constitution? | the bill of rights |
| What did the declaration of independence do? | Announce our independence from Great Britain Said that the United States is free from great Britain |
| What is one right or freedom from the first amendment | * speech * religion * assembly * press * petition the government |
| What does the judicial branch do? | * review laws * explains laws * resolves disputes * decides if the law goes against the constitution |
| Who is the governor of your state now? | Kathleen C Hochul |
| Why do some states have more representatives than other states? | * Because of the states population * Because they have more people |
| what is one of your states US senators now? | Kristen E. Gillibrand |
